Cross-shell states in $^{15}$C: a test for p-sd interactions
Abstract
The low-lying structure of C has been investigated via the neutron-removal C reaction. Along with bound neutron sd-shell hole states, unbound p-shell hole states have been firmly confirmed. The excitation energies and the deduced spectroscopic factors of the cross-shell states are an important measure of the neutron configurations in C. Our results show a very good agreement with shell-model calculations using the SFO-tls interaction for C. However, a modification of the - and - monopole terms was applied in order to reproduce the isotone O. In addition, the excitation energies and spectroscopic factors have been compared to the first calculations of C with the self-consistent Green's function method employing the NNLO interaction. The results show the sensitivity to the size of the shell gap and highlight the need of going beyond the current truncation scheme in the theory.
